Decimal value is truncating to 4 when user enters 5 decimals

SA-23154

Summary



Decimal value is truncating to four decimals when user enters five decimals, that is the number will be saved as 0.1235 instead of 0.12345.


Error Messages



Not Applicable.


Steps to Reproduce



1. Try to update 'threshold value' 
for example: 0.1234 is modified to 0.12345 and click on save.
 It will generate approval number.
2. Logoff and login to same application with different user name.
4. Search for approval number from the dashboard open it and click on submit button by entering note. After approval is done logoff and login to same application with previous user
Issue : See the updatevalue the number will be saved as 0.1235 instead of 0.12345.


Root Cause



A defect in Pegasystems’ code or rules The issue is with AuditThreshold property rule form whose advanced tab has pyDecimalPrecision qualifier with value 4.


Resolution



Perform the following local-change: 
Increase the value in pyDecimalPrecision qualifier by saving it in higher ruleset.
